Subject: Re: FW: [eqenchanters] Re: Question on enchanter pets


Charmed creatures are indeed able to be commanded. Enchanter pets, though
in permanent follow mode, will engage ANY creature if it attacks you (unlike
other pets who just wont fight). The enchanter pet is loyal until death.
It will not run.
